We gave this a lot of thought when we were trying to determine how best to get as many people as possible to get into Star Hero and the Traveller universe. Our basic plan for Traveller Hero from a business perspective is three fold: 1. Provide gamers with a fun and entertaining game (obviously) 2. Expand the market for Star Hero and Traveller: Many gamers don't recognize the Hero System as a very good science fiction game. I believe that Traveller fans are natural fits with the Hero System, but I have been surprised at how much misunderstanding there is about the Hero System within the Traveller community. My hope is that Traveller Hero will expand the market for Star Hero, just as it introduces more Hero gamers to Traveller. To accomplish this, we are planning on spending profits from this game on marketing Traveller Hero in hopes that it will expand the market. 3. Impress the folks at Hero Games enough to expand our license to a broader science fiction license, which will enable us to produce alien books, etc. This is where we are hoping to capitalize on the expanding market. To best accomplish these goals, we had three options: 1. Distribution at the low price we wanted to charge: Most of our print books are sold thru both the game and book trade distribution systems. As a small company, we have to use a consolidator in order to get carried by game distributors (such as Alliance). After the distributor cut and our consolidator's cut, we get 34% of MSRP to pay for printing, all the shipping, licenses, etc. At the price we want to sell it at we would only get 14 cents per copy sold (no exaggeration) after printing, shipping, licensors and our creative partners were paid. If we sold 100 copies, we would have 14 dollars to put into marketing. The book trade, on the other hand (distributors like Ingram, Baker & Taylor, etc) allow us to 'short discount' the book (which means we can discount it by only 35%), and will get it picked up by the online etailers (such as Amazon, BN.com, etc). This will allow people to order the books thru alternate venues, and not prevent us from making anything on them. 2. Distribution at a higher price: We could increase the price of the books in order to make game distribution of this book viable. We decided that the price we would have to raise it to in order to be viable would be too high to compete in the market. 3. Distribution thru our online store, book trade, possibly direct to retailers: We decided that this was the best bet, so that we could keep the price of the book much lower. Please understand that we *do* support FLGSs--we intentionally don't allow Amazon a discount that would enable them to undercut the MSRP, and look for ways to encourage people to support their FLGS. However, on this product, we just couldn't keep the price down and distribute thru the game trade distribution system. Whew... sorry for writing so much to a fairly simple question.
